"Lubrication" is the reduction of friction to a minimum by the replacement of solid friction with fluid friction.

(...) l'interposition d'une couche fluide entre des surfaces frottantes diminue la résistance au glissement, le frottement à sec étant remplacé par le frottement des couches fluides entres elles (...) Si l'épaisseur de la couche fluide est suffisante pour que les aspérités des deux pièces ne puissent venir en contact, le frottement est fluide ou hydrodynamique.
